The Russia Brittney Griner trial is resuming amid intensified diplomacy.

If conviction is a foregone conclusion, it would also potentially be a step forward. Russian officials have said no release of Griner could occur until the judicial process is completed.

"It seems that she is in fact being used as a political bargaining chip - and the administration has already designated her as wrongfully detained presumably because they think she is being used as a political pawn," Tom Firestone told The Associated Press.
